Output 858e3dfb1fec744f570a8aa7eda703c2cc3cac77bc44cd242263da9280c2e4ba:9

value
341931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bd608e13a91050ed8b5e9a4792fda0d52682018 OP_EQUAL
address
35goPBaZk8sftrav3aq64qvx9kHyqevLAj
transaction
858e3dfb1fec744f570a8aa7eda703c2cc3cac77bc44cd242263da9280c2e4ba
spent
true